We are recruiting an experienced Bagging Operative to join a busy food manufacturing site based in HU3, Hull. This role offers ongoing, regular work with excellent pay progression for the right candidate.

Important

Applicants must be available for interview, assessment and induction before January, including availability during the festive period, to secure a January start.

Start Information

  • Training: January (w.c 5th January)
  • Full duties commence: February

Shift Pattern

  • 2 x 12-hour Day shifts (6am–6pm)
  • 1 day off
  • 2 x 12-hour Night shifts (6pm–6am)
  • 3 days off

Pay & Benefits

  • £12.25 per hour during training
  • £16.78 per hour once fully trained
  • Overtime £20.56 per hour after 36 / 48 hours
  • 3 x 20-minute paid breaks

Duties

  • Operating bagging machinery
  • Monitoring product weights and accuracy
  • Quality checks and documentation
  • Working to food safety and hygiene standards

Requirements

  • Previous bagging or relevant factory experience essential
  • Food manufacturing experience preferred
  • Ability to work 12-hour day and night shifts
  • Strong attention to detail and reliability
